Certification helps enterprise management quickly qualify potential new hires, as well as keep current development teams on top of the latest PHP technology. The company also announced certification exams are now available in Japanese and German, as the worldwide demand for enterprise-grade PHP development continues to grow. Major corporations, such as Vodafone Terenci GmbH, Veritas and McAfee are examples of enterprise customers who look to hire Zend Certified Engineers, or want to develop them internally so they have the most qualified PHP developers where it matters most -- on mission critical Web application development teams. "As one of the PHP enterprise developers at McAfee, it is crucial that we recruit top PHP talent for our team," said Jim Plush, lead PHP enterprise developer for McAfee. "We cannot afford to spend three months trying people out in the enterprise world. Being able to screen people using the Zend Certified Engineer test would save us time and money. Currently, developers with certification climb right to the top of our 'must talk to' list." Zend PHP Certification Zend established an industry advisory committee to drive the creation of an industry standard in PHP certification that recognizes PHP expertise, with a focus on application performance and security. With this certification, engineers are better able to manage PHP development within their own organizations, or if they are looking for employment, become even more attractive to potential employers. Employers needing top-notch PHP developers use the ZCE designation to better evaluate prospective employees. The ZCE program is identical in concept to other well-known certification programs from leading software companies that are the originators of industry standards. The PHP Certification exam, available in English, German and Japanese, encompasses curriculum specified by the product-neutral Zend PHP Education Advisory Board. The Board's members are among the most well known and respected in the PHP community.
